
Nonfungible token (NFT) entrepreneur Wylie Aronow of Yuga Labs – the team behind Bored Ape Yacht Club (BAYC) and CryptoPunks – will take a leave of absence from work to manage a host of heart failure symptoms.
In a Jan. 28 Twitter post to his 144,900 followers, Aronow said the difficult decision to retire came in the wake of a heart failure diagnosis after experiencing multiple symptoms over the past few months.
Some serious news: a few days ago I was told by the doctor that I have congestive heart failure. The symptoms started last year out of the blue and I didn’t ask for help (like an idiot) to continue working. But after the test, my doctor called me and asked me to radically change my life.
— GordonGoner.eth (Wylie Aronow) (@GordonGoner) January 28, 2023
The NFT businessman explained that while his “mild” symptoms still allow him to live a “mostly normal life”, his condition has worsened so quickly that he has no other choice but to prioritize his work.
The founder of Yuga Labs has not set a date for when he hopes to make a full recovery and return to his daily duties.
However, Aranow confirmed that he will remain as a board member and strategic advisor.
This is not the first medical diagnosis that has put Aranow out of work.
Aranow revealed that he developed a chronic illness in his twenties that prevented him from advancing in his career. So when he finally recovered and founded Yuga Labs, there was no more:
“When I recovered and started Yuga, I didn’t want to waste my second chance in life. I pushed myself way past my limits. I worked 12 hours a day, almost every day. I had to take advice from everyone around me and find a balance .
“My goal now is to get the best possible medical care and cure,” he said.

Aronow also expressed his excitement to work with the company’s new CEO, Daniel Alegre, former president and chief operating officer of Activision Blizzard.
While Aronow did not elaborate on what he will do as a strategic advisor, Aronow recently announced on November 8 that he will propose a new model for NFT creator royalties.
Aronow co-founded Yuga Labs with Greg Solano in February 2021.
Among the most famous NFTs developed by the company are CryptoPunks, BAYC, MeeBits and Othersidemeta.
